While Rugeley Trent Valley may not rival the grandeur of some larger stations, it’s well-equipped for those who seek simplicity and efficiency. Although there is no ticket office, the station offers ticket machines where travelers can collect tickets purchased online, ensuring a smooth start to your journey. The machines cater to everyone, offering accessible features such as induction loops and are equipped for smartcard usage, even though smartcards are not issued at this station.
Despite its compact size, Rugeley Trent Valley station is dedicated to supporting its passengers, especially when it comes to accessibility. The station boasts step-free access through certain parts, making it easier for passengers with mobility challenges to navigate. Although the toilets and waiting room facilities are limited, the seating area provides a comfortable spot to relax while waiting for your train. Plus, with CCTV coverage, security is another aspect taken seriously here.
For those who prefer cycling to driving, the station offers bicycle storage with 16 spaces and CCTV security, perfect for eco-conscious travelers. Meanwhile, motorists will find the SABA UK-operated car park handy, offering 19 parking spaces, including one accessible space.
Once you’ve arrived at Rugeley Trent Valley, onward travel is straightforward. If your journey is disrupted, a rail replacement service operates from the station car park. For further convenience, taxi services are readily available through local providers such as RGL Station Aline and Chase. While the direct bus links are limited, a printable format of routes and timetables is accessible online, making it easy to plan your journey comprehensively.

Hunts Cross station ensures a smooth experience for travelers with its range of facilities. The ticket office is open every day, providing easy access for acquiring and collecting tickets during a variety of hours. Though the station doesn't have ticket machines, online tickets can be conveniently collected from the ticket office. This station is equipped with smartcard validators, providing a modern touch for frequent commuters.
Step-free access throughout the station classifies it as a Category A, making it inclusive for travelers with mobility challenges. Security is well-maintained with CCTV coverage, ensuring a safe environment. However, note that while there are accessible toilets, the station lacks waiting room facilities. With Merseyrail operating the car park offering 30 spaces, parking is free, adding to the station's convenience. Do remember, though, that refreshment facilities and an ATM are not available, so plan accordingly before visiting.
Beyond the train services, Hunts Cross links efficiently with other transportation modes. For those moments when rail services are replaced, pickups and drop-offs are smoothly managed outside the station entrance on Speke Road. Taxis have a dedicated pickup/drop-off point, ensuring a seamless transition to your next destination. Buses are readily available; details can be obtained through Merseytravel or by contacting the Traveline.
Travelers eyeing upcoming flights can benefit from a combined Rail/Bus ticket straight from the station to Liverpool John Lennon Airport. With the 86A or 80A buses taking you from Liverpool South Parkway station, the airport is just a short ride away, amplifying the connectivity Hunts Cross station offers.
